Expression of Toll-like receptors 3, 7, and 9 in peripheral blood mononuclear cells and prognosis of pneumonia in hospital-admitted coronavirus disease 2019 patients: is there an association?

Abstract

Abstract

Background
Toll-like receptors (TLRs) identify the very early signs of cell damage or infection. They play essential roles in host immunity response against severe acute respiratory syndrome coronavirus 2 infection. The current study investigated the association between the TLR 3, 7, and 9 and the outcome and severity of coronavirus disease 2019 (COVID-19) pneumonia.


Patients and methods
Demographic characteristics, clinical presentations, radiological, and laboratory data were registered and analyzed. Real time polymerase chain reaction quantification (qRT-PCR) of TLRs on peripheral blood mononuclear cells in blood samples collected from COVID-19 patients.


Results

The study involved 74 hospital-admitted COVID-19 pneumonia patients. The majority of cases were critically ill (62.2%), while 2.7% were moderate and 35.1% were severe cases. Median TLR7 and TLR9 were significantly higher among critically ill cases in comparison to moderate and severe cases (3.3 and 4.5 vs. 2.2 and 2.7,
P
=0.001 and 0.002, respectively). Nonsurvivors (48.6%) showed significantly higher levels for TLR3, TLR7, and TLR9 (
P
=0.000 for all). TLR7 and TLR9 had significant correlation with TLR3 (r=0.697, 0.705, and
P
=0.000 for both) while TLR7 showed a significant correlation with TLR9 (r=0.845 and
P
=0.000). TLR3, TLR7, and TLR9 had significant positive correlation with lymphocyte count, serum ferritin, C-reactive protein, D-Dimer (
P
≤0.001 for all). TLR7, TLR9, C-reactive protein, and D-Dimer were predictors for the severity of COVID-19 pneumonia.



Conclusion
Transcript levels of TLR3, TLR7, and TLR9 may be considered promising markers for estimating the clinical severity and outcome in COVID-19 patients.
